About Us: Brat Climpson’s Arch is a dynamic and passionate neighbourhood restaurant serving seasonal wood‑fired dishes in a unique courtyard space beneath the arches of London Fields. We place great importance on our relationships with suppliers and ensure staff are well informed about the produce we use. Located in the space where Chef Tomos Parry’s independent cooking style first took shape, the restaurant reflects that same energy. Our menu and wine list change daily. Brat x Climpson’s Arch is a friendly, enthusiastic restaurant that offers the chance to work with some of the best produce in the UK while building strong culinary knowledge and skill.

What you’ll be doing:

  • Managing a section in a fast‑paced environment while ensuring timely service.
  • Providing exceptional hospitality and customer care.
  • Sharing your in‑depth knowledge of our products and suppliers with guests.
  • Aligning your work with our company values and brand ethos.
  • Being efficient in all aspects of service and adept at multitasking.
  • Collaborating effectively as part of a team.
  • Participating in and contributing to daily briefings and in‑house training sessions.
  • Overseeing the front‑of‑house team to ensure seamless operations across all sections.
  • Inspiring, motivating, and training the waiting team to deliver outstanding service.
  • Leading and executing all opening, handover, and closing duties to prepare the restaurant and FOH team for timely briefings.

What you’ll bring:

  • Passion and knowledge of restaurants, good cooking, good sourcing of food and drink are a great head‑start.
  • Previous experience as a supervisor, head waiter, or waitress in a similar fast‑paced setting.
  • A creative mindset with a keen eye for detail.
  • A desire to grow and progress your career within our restaurant group.
  • Confidence and hands‑on leadership skills.
  • Flexibility to work varied shifts across 5 out of 7 days.
  • Full UK right to work documents.

What’s in it for you:

  • 28 days of annual leave, including bank holidays.
  • Access to courses, resources, and training to enhance your career.
  • 50% discount at all our restaurants, along with complimentary staff meals during your shifts.
  • Discounted dining at various local establishments near Super 8 Restaurants.
  • Enhanced maternity leave, pension scheme, subsidised mental health support, and a cycle‑to‑work scheme.
  • Refer a Friend scheme—recommend someone to join Super 8 and receive a bonus!
  • Opportunities for both international and national travel to visit our suppliers and learn about sourcing ingredients and beverages.
  • £300 contribution towards the purchase of a work laptop for all salaried staff members.
